upgpkg: audiofile 0.3.6-5

Adding patch for running tests (02_hurd.patch) and patches for CVE-2018-13440 (11_CVE-2018-13440.patch) and CVE-2018-17095 (12_CVE-2018-17095.patch), provided by Debian and unmerged fixes by Wim Taymans (respectively).
Simplifying the application of the (many) patches in prepare(). Running autoreconf in prepare().
Running make check in check() and installing docs. Switching to correct license (GPL2 and LGPL2.1) and updating maintainer. Adding libaudiofile.so to provides.

+From fde6d79fb8363c4a329a184ef0b107156602b225 Mon Sep 17 00:00:00 2001
+From: Wim Taymans <wtaymans at redhat.com>
+Date: Thu, 27 Sep 2018 10:48:45 +0200
+Subject: [PATCH] ModuleState: handle compress/decompress init failure
+
+When the unit initcompress or initdecompress function fails,
+m_fileModule is NULL. Return AF_FAIL in that case instead of
+causing NULL pointer dereferences later.
+
+Fixes #49
+---
+ libaudiofile/modules/ModuleState.cpp | 3 +++
+ 1 file changed, 3 insertions(+)
+
+diff --git a/libaudiofile/modules/ModuleState.cpp b/libaudiofile/modules/ModuleState.cpp
+index 0c29d7a..070fd9b 100644
+--- a/libaudiofile/modules/ModuleState.cpp
++++ b/libaudiofile/modules/ModuleState.cpp
+@@ -75,6 +75,9 @@ status ModuleState::initFileModule(AFfilehandle file, Track *track)
+ 		m_fileModule = unit->initcompress(track, file->m_fh, file->m_seekok,
+ 			file->m_fileFormat == AF_FILE_RAWDATA, &chunkFrames);
+ 
++	if (!m_fileModule)
++		return AF_FAIL;
++
+ 	if (unit->needsRebuffer)
+ 	{
+ 		assert(unit->nativeSampleFormat == AF_SAMPFMT_TWOSCOMP);

+From 822b732fd31ffcb78f6920001e9b1fbd815fa712 Mon Sep 17 00:00:00 2001
+From: Wim Taymans <wtaymans at redhat.com>
+Date: Thu, 27 Sep 2018 12:11:12 +0200
+Subject: [PATCH] SimpleModule: set output chunk framecount after pull
+
+After pulling the data, set the output chunk to the amount of
+frames we pulled so that the next module in the chain has the correct
+frame count.
+
+Fixes #50 and #51
+---
+ libaudiofile/modules/SimpleModule.cpp | 1 +
+ 1 file changed, 1 insertion(+)
+
+diff --git a/libaudiofile/modules/SimpleModule.cpp b/libaudiofile/modules/SimpleModule.cpp
+index 2bae1eb..e87932c 100644
+--- a/libaudiofile/modules/SimpleModule.cpp
++++ b/libaudiofile/modules/SimpleModule.cpp
+@@ -26,6 +26,7 @@
+ void SimpleModule::runPull()
+ {
+ 	pull(m_outChunk->frameCount);
++	m_outChunk->frameCount = m_inChunk->frameCount;
+ 	run(*m_inChunk, *m_outChunk);
+ }
